### `@relationship(from: attribute, to: attribute)` — foreign key to foreign key

Both `from` and `to` can be specified together to define a relationship where neither side uses the primary key — a foreign key to foreign key join. This is useful for many-to-many relationships that join on non-primary-key attributes.
Both `from` and `to` can be specified together to define a relationship where neither side uses the primary key — a foreign key to foreign key join. As with the `to`-only form above, the result type must be an array: Harper resolves it by searching the target table's `to` attribute for matches, using this record's `from` attribute (instead of its primary key) as the search value.
